As you may or may not have heard, Geocities is going away 'later this year' (http://help.yahoo.com/l/us/yahoo/geocit ... es-05.html). This is significant because there are a -lot- of good sites dedcated to older games on Geocities that will just disappear, like what happened last year when AOL closed its Hometown.
I bring this up because I have a -ton- (almost literally) of web space that I would be more than happy to give some of these sites a new home. If you or someone you know has a site (or know a site that the owner has long since disappeared and you deem it to be an important contribution to the community) has a site that needs the space, please feel free to contact me either by PM here or by EM and I will see what I can do.
It really irks me when I go looking for a resource and it has suffered a spontaneous massive existance failure.
